Lyndon Dykes a one-cap wonder to tie him down to Scotland. The Livingston forward is finalising a £2 million move to QPR after making a huge impact with Gary Holt's side last season.
Dykes is eligible to play for both Scotland and Australia, but with the Socceroos not now due to play a game until next year after the postponement of their World Cup qualifiers, Scots boss Clarke looks set to call him up for next month's Nations League clashes with Israel and Czech Republic, which would tie him up to Scotland.
